摘要

Recent molecular-dynamics simulations have suggested that the arginine-rich HIV Tat peptides translocate by destabilizing and inducing transient pores in phospholipid bilayers. In this pathway for peptide translocation, Arg residues play a fundamental role not only in the binding of the peptide to the surface of the membrane, but also in the destabilization and nucleation of transient pores across the bilayer. Here we present a molecular-dynamics simulation of a peptide composed of nine Args (Arg-9) that shows that this peptide follows the same translocation pathway previously found for the Tat peptide. We test experimentally the hypothesis that transient pores open by measuring ionic currents across phospholipid bilayers and cell membranes through the pores induced by Arg-9 peptides. We find that Arg-9 peptides, in the presence of an electrostatic potential gradient, induce ionic currents across planar phospholipid bilayers, as well as in cultured osteosarcoma cells and human smooth muscle cells. Our results suggest that the mechanism of action of Arg-9 peptides involves the creation of transient pores in lipid bilayers and cell membranes.
机译:最近的分子动力学模拟表明,富含精氨酸的HIV Tat肽通过破坏和诱导磷脂双层中的瞬时孔而易位。在这种肽易位的途径中,Arg残基不仅在肽与膜表面的结合中起着基本作用,而且在整个双层中的瞬时孔的失稳和成核中也起着基本作用。在这里,我们介绍了一个由9个Args(Arg-9)组成的肽的分子动力学模拟,表明该肽遵循先前为Tat肽发现的相同易位途径。我们通过实验测试了以下假设:通过测量跨Arg-9肽诱导的孔的磷脂双层和细胞膜上的离子电流,可以打开瞬时孔。我们发现,在存在静电势梯度的情况下,Arg-9肽可诱导跨平面磷脂双层以及培养的骨肉瘤细胞和人平滑肌细胞中的离子电流。我们的结果表明,Arg-9肽的作用机制涉及在脂质双层和细胞膜中创建瞬时孔。
